Output cf38b8fb3de33ddf36132b8f68a0c0527b3462901ee4fedc5e593b3bd9360de9:21

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ab570e581387dd22b6018c2c8d2ba0af36cedfbf59f57508696e02abc8fc55a
address
bc1p326hpevp8p7ay2mqrrpv3546ptekem0m7k04w5yxjmsz40y0c4dq8f7ud2
transaction
cf38b8fb3de33ddf36132b8f68a0c0527b3462901ee4fedc5e593b3bd9360de9
spent
true